The mortgage market has started to see a light at the end of the tunnel as this summer saw the number of mortgages taken out by first-time buyers reach a ten-month high. According to the Council of Mortgage Lenders, the number of loans given to borrowers in June 2011 was 24% higher than the previous month and the highest since August 2010*.

The award-winning housing developer is offering its popular EasyBuy scheme exclusively to first-time buyers at Penarth Heights in Penarth, allowing them to purchase a property with only a small deposit.

Laura Osborne, Sales Manager for Crest Nicholson Wales, explains: “This news is exactly what the property market needs. Lending is improving steadily for first-time buyers who only have a small deposit and Crest Nicholson will continue to support new purchasers to help them onto the ladder.

“The EasyBuy scheme’s popularity is a reflection of the recent market results and although the industry may not be out of the woods just yet, it’s encouraging to see that confidence is returning to the property market.”

With EasyBuy, purchasers have an opportunity to own 100 per cent of their new home at 85 per cent of the price, paying no rent or interest on the outstanding 15 per cent for the first five years.

With beautiful views across the Marina, Penarth Heights offers a range of stylish homes and apartments suitable for first time buyers. The development of 377 properties includes a mix of contemporary one, two, four and five bedroom homes on the first phase – a small percentage of which will be affordable homes.
